Let's explore each of these roles in more detail: 1. **Trade Agreement Analyst**: These professionals are responsible for analyzing and interpreting trade agreements between countries, identifying potential opportunities, and mitigating risks. They work with government agencies, private companies, and legal firms to ensure compliance with various trade regulations. 2. **Maritime Security Specialist**: As the demand for secure and efficient maritime transportation grows, so does the need for maritime security experts. They develop and implement security policies and procedures for maritime organizations, monitor potential threats, and coordinate responses to security incidents. 3. **International Trade Compliance**: Ensuring adherence to international trade regulations is a crucial responsibility of these professionals. They manage the import/export processes, perform risk assessments, and maintain up-to-date knowledge of trade laws and regulations. 4. **Import/Export Coordinator**: Coordinators in this role facilitate the smooth flow of goods across international borders. They manage documentation, track shipments, and communicate with various stakeholders, such as suppliers, customers, and customs officials.
